  6. flo88 Posted messages 28529 Registration date   Status Contributor Last intervention   Ambassador 5 181
     

    Hello everyone.

    Just to point out that apparently with W11 you only need to install the drivers for W10.

    In any case, it worked here: https://www.google.fr/url?sa=t&rct=j&q=&esrc=s&source=web&cd=&cad=rja&uact=8&ved=2ahUKEwi687-O0eX_AhU4TqQEHUQXBSUQFnoECBYQAQ&url=https%3A%2F%2Fanswers.microsoft.com%2Ffr-fr%2Fwindows%2Fforum%2Fall%2Fmon-imprimante-canon-mp550-nest-pas-reconnue%2Fd241a199-5739-4d11-bd96-f843be92b7a1&usg=AOvVaw3q7HX1SvfhrpuXh6qyXZj-&opi=89978449

    Another point, if there are other drivers for another printer present on the PC, you need to uninstall them first.
